The guy who chops it.

I buy trailer loads of the stuff, actually chops pretty well once the mills get over it coming in as a flake and not a chop.

If you are getting any good quantity of wire and not selling to a chopper (and I mean a real chopping line,not one of those Chinese toys) you are leaving money on the table.

Old radiators were brass, newish ones are aluminum.

At my yard: Clean brass rads: 2.80 Clean aluminum rads: .65

Still with iron and plastic, take off at least 30%.

Pipe usually comes in 70/30 and 85/15 varieties. Most often it’s 70/30… historically about 3/4 for us. If your yard buys it as pipe, they most likely buy as 70/30 or mixed. Call the yard and ask though.

I mean, it varies depending on what it is. We grade wire based on copper content not arbitrary categories. Today we paid 1.10 for crappy low grade cords, we paid 2.00 for communication type #2. High grade #2 battery cable we paid over 3.00.

Agreed. Remember, the machinery companies want to sell the machines and they will swear up and down that it can do everything.

Only the biggest choppers process harness wire because it is so difficult and even then, they have specialized processes for it.
